The outstanding funding questions arising from

decisions taken by OD (K) on 4 October are as follows:

(a)

Emergency_accommodation

The

We have agreed to assist the Hong Kong Government to

make improvements to the emergency accommodation

under construction, so as to ensure that it is secure

and able to withstand severe weather conditions.

Hong Kong Government have estimated that £5.6 million

will be required from us in the current rinancial

year. A detailed breakdown of expenditure is set out

at Annex A.

(b) Long term accommodation

The Hong Kong Government have asked us to make a 50%

contribution to the funding of a new long-term camp

on Tai a Chau to provide accommodation for the

inevitable influx of Vietnamese boat people in spring

and summer 1990 and to allow other camps in much

needed development areas to be shut down in due

course. The Hong Kong Government estimate that

£13 million will be required from us, £5 million

falling in the current financial year. The case for

this expenditure is set out at Annex B.
